| | April 14, 2008 Sterling Announces Private Placement
|
| | Wallace, Idaho -- April 14, 2008 -- (Marketwire) - Sterling Mining Company (TSX:SMQ / OTCBB:SRLM / FSE:SMX) announces that it has commenced an equity financing of up to US$5 million by way of non-brokered private placement. The placement will consist of 2,083,334 units at US$2.40 per unit.
Each unit will be comprised of one common share, a one-half common share purchase "A" warrant, and a one-half common share purchase "B" warrant. Each whole share purchase "A" warrant is exercisable for one common share at $3.40 per share for 18 months from the date of closing. Each whole share purchase "B" warrant is exercisable for one common share at $4.10 per share for 36 months from the date of closing. As proposed, Sterling Mining will undertake to file a registration statement in the United States under the Securities Act of 1933 to register for resale the shares of common stock, including common stock underlying the warrants, issued in the private placement.
Empire Financial Group ("Empire") of San Francisco will act as placement agent in the United States in connection with the placement. The Company will pay a placement fee in cash of 7.0% of the gross proceeds of the placement, and has agreed to pay a similar fee in cash of 7% on the gross proceeds of warrants exercised, if, and when exercised. In addition, Empire will receive up to 200,000 common share purchase warrants exercisable at $3.40 for 18 months from the date of closing.
The financing is subject to board and regulatory approval.
Proceeds from the financing will be used by the Company to purchase underground diesel equipment, accelerate exploration activities and for general working capital. The 2008 equipment purchases scheduled to arrive in the first half of the year are in addition to $3.8 million in underground diesel equipment received in 2007, which is currently being used for production activities on the 3100 level at the Sunshine Mine.

About Sterling Mining Company
Sterling Mining controls the Sunshine Mine, which began initial production in December 2007, and related exploration lands in the prolific Silver Valley of northern Idaho. The Company also holds several silver properties in Mexico, including the Barones Tailings Project in the Zacatecas Silver District.
